Where to stay in Chania

Find the best Chania are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most.

Old Town Chania

Old Town Chania captivates visitors with its stunning Venetian harbor and iconic lighthouse standing sentinel over turquoise waters. Narrow cobblestone alleys wind past honey-colored buildings with wrought-iron balconies. Ottoman mosques rise beside Venetian churches, revealing centuries of Mediterranean history in every corner. The vibrant waterfront comes alive with tavernas serving fresh seafood and authentic Cretan specialties. Artisan shops offer handcrafted leather goods, textiles, and local olive oil. Most attractions are within walking distance, making it easy to explore this charming historical district at your own pace.

Nea Chora

Discover Nea Chora, a coastal gem with golden beaches hugging crystalline Mediterranean waters. Traditional fishing boats dot the small harbor while whitewashed tavernas line the shore. This budget-friendly neighborhood balances local charm with tourist appeal. The 2km waterfront promenade invites leisurely walks with tamarisk trees providing natural shade. Family-run tavernas serve fresh seafood and authentic Cretan dishes at prices lower than Old Town. Nea Chora offers clean, simple accommodations where location trumps luxury, perfect for travelers seeking genuine Greek experiences.

Koum Kapi

Koum Kapi charms visitors with its scenic Mediterranean promenade and rich multicultural heritage. This coastal neighborhood showcases well-preserved Venetian and Ottoman architecture alongside Chania's old city walls. Small pebble beaches nestle between ancient stones where travelers can enjoy crystal-clear waters. The waterfront comes alive at sunset when tavernas and cafes fill with locals and visitors. Traditional Greek seafood restaurants offer harbor views while gentle waves provide a soothing soundtrack. Walking is the best way to explore this historic area with its honey-colored buildings and blue-shuttered windows.

Halepa

Halepa showcases elegant neoclassical mansions from Crete's diplomatic era. The cream and ochre facades tell stories of 19th-century grandeur along tree-lined streets. This tranquil neighborhood offers stunning harbor views from its hillside position. Travelers can explore the Venizelos Family Tombs for panoramic vistas. The historic Russian Hospital stands as a testament to Cretan-Russian relations. Local tavernas serve authentic island cuisine in this genuine Greek residential area. With minimal tourist crowds, Halepa provides a peaceful retreat just minutes from Chania's bustling center. Visitors experience authentic neighborhood life amid architectural treasures.

Chania Town

Chania Town blends Venetian, Ottoman, and Byzantine influences to create Crete's most enchanting historic district. The iconic harbor, crowned by a 16th-century lighthouse, becomes magical at sunset when golden light bathes honey-colored buildings. Cobblestone lanes reveal hidden treasures around every corner. Wander through the maze-like alleys to discover artisan shops selling leather goods and local ceramics. The Municipal Market offers authentic Cretan flavors while waterfront tavernas serve fresh seafood. Most attractions are within walking distance, making this pedestrian-friendly neighborhood perfect for history lovers and photographers.

Best time to go to Chania

The best time to visit Chania is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January52.9°F (11.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April60.4°F (15.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
May67.1°F (19.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June73.9°F (23.3°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
July78.4°F (25.8°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August78.6°F (25.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September74.3°F (23.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
October68.0°F (20.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
November62.2°F (16.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
December56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ather like in Chania?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 76°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 55°F. Average annual precipitation for Chania is 36 inches.
